Công cụ sau đây trực quan hóa những gì máy tính đang làm từng bước khi nó thực thi chương trình nói trên
Trình chỉnh sửa mã Python
Có một cách khác để giải quyết giải pháp này?
Trước. Viết chương trình Python để in một số phức và phần thực và phần ảo của nó.
Tiếp theo. Viết chương trình Python để lấy độ dài và góc của một số phức.
Mức độ khó của bài tập này là gì?
Dễ dàng trung bình khóKiểm tra kỹ năng Lập trình của bạn với bài kiểm tra của w3resource
con trăn. Lời khuyên trong ngày
In nâng cao
Bạn có muốn in nhiều giá trị bằng dấu tách do người dùng xác định không?
Trong hướng dẫn về trăn này, bạn sẽ tìm hiểu về chương trình Python để trừ hai số và chúng ta cũng sẽ kiểm tra
- Chương trình Python để trừ hai số
- Chương trình Python để trừ hai số bằng hàm
- Chương trình Python để trừ hai số người dùng nhập vào
- Cách trừ biến trong python
- Chương trình trừ hai số float bằng hàm
- Chương trình trừ số phức trong python
- Chương trình trừ các số bằng cách sử dụng lớp
- Lập trình trừ các số không dùng toán tử số học
- Chương trình Python để trừ hai số nhị phân
Mục lục
- Chương trình Python để trừ hai số
- Chương trình Python để trừ hai số bằng hàm
- Chương trình Python để trừ hai số người dùng nhập vào
- Cách trừ biến trong python
- Chương trình trừ hai số float bằng hàm
- Chương trình trừ số phức trong python
- Chương trình trừ các số sử dụng lớp
- Lập trình trừ các số không dùng toán tử số học
- Chương trình Python để trừ hai số nhị phân
Chương trình Python để trừ hai số
Sau đây chúng ta xem chương trình trừ hai số trong python
- Trong ví dụ này, tôi đã lấy hai số là số1 = 10 và số2 = 7
- Toán tử “-“ được sử dụng để trừ hai số
- Tôi đã sử dụng print[number] để lấy đầu ra
Thí dụ
number1 = 10
number2 = 7
number = number1 - number2
print[number]
Ảnh chụp màn hình bên dưới hiển thị kết quả là đầu ra
Đây là cách trừ hai số trong Python
Đọc, Chương trình Python để kiểm tra năm nhuận
Chương trình Python để trừ hai số bằng hàm
Sau đây chúng ta xem cách viết chương trình trừ hai số bằng hàm trong python
- Trong ví dụ này, tôi đã định nghĩa một hàm là def sub[num1,num2]
- Hàm được trả về với biểu thức là return[num1-num2]
- Các giá trị bị trừ được truyền dưới dạng tham số trong hàm như print[sub[90,70]]
Thí dụ
def sub[num1,num2]:
return[num1-num2]
print[sub[90,70]]
Bạn có thể tham khảo ảnh chụp màn hình bên dưới để biết đầu ra
Mã này, chúng ta có thể sử dụng để trừ hai số bằng một hàm trong Python
Chương trình Python để trừ hai số người dùng nhập vào
Bây giờ, chúng ta có thể xem cách viết chương trình trừ hai số do người dùng nhập vào trong python
- Trong ví dụ này, tôi đã sử dụng phương thức input[]. Để lấy đầu vào từ người dùng
- Tôi đã sử dụng c = a-b để trừ các số
- Hàm print[“The result is”,c] được sử dụng để lấy kết quả
Thí dụ
a = int[input["Enter a first number\n"]]
b = int[input["Enter a second number\n"]]
c = a-b
print["The result is",c]
Ảnh chụp màn hình bên dưới hiển thị đầu ra
Cách trừ biến trong python
Ở đây, chúng ta có thể xem cách trừ các biến trong python
- Trong ví dụ này, tôi đã lấy hai biến là biến1 và biến2
- Biến1 được gán là biến1 = 100, biến2 được gán là biến2 = 65
- Để trừ các biến, tôi đã sử dụng toán tử “-“
- Tôi đã sử dụng print[variable] để lấy kết quả
Thí dụ
variable1 = 100
variable2 = 65
variable = variable1 - variable2
print[variable]
Kết quả được hiển thị dưới dạng đầu ra. Bạn có thể tham khảo ảnh chụp màn hình bên dưới để biết đầu ra
Đoạn mã trên, chúng ta có thể sử dụng để trừ các biến trong Python
Chương trình trừ hai số float bằng hàm
Ở đây, chúng ta có thể thấy chương trình trừ hai số float bằng một hàm trong python
- Trong ví dụ này, tôi đã sử dụng phương thức input[]. Để lấy đầu vào từ người dùng
- Kiểu dữ liệu float được sử dụng để nhập các số thập phân làm đầu vào
- Tôi đã định nghĩa một hàm gọi là phép trừ là phép trừ def[a,b]
- Để trừ các số, tôi đã sử dụng sub=a-b
- Hàm được trả về dưới dạng return sub
- Để có được đầu ra, tôi đã sử dụng print[“Result is. “,phép trừ[số1,số2]]
Thí dụ
number1=float[input["Enter first number: "]]
number2=float[input["Enter second number: "]]
def subtraction[a,b]:
sub=a-b
return sub
print["Result is: ",subtraction[number1,number2]]
Ảnh chụp màn hình bên dưới hiển thị phép trừ hai số làm đầu ra
Mã này, chúng ta có thể sử dụng để trừ hai số float bằng một hàm trong Python
Chương trình trừ số phức trong python
Sau đây chúng ta cùng xem cách viết chương trình trừ số phức trong python
- Trong ví dụ này, tôi đã lấy hai số phức là a = phức[9, 8] và b = phức[3, 5]
- Hàm complex[] được sử dụng để trả về số phức bằng cách chỉ định một số thực và một số ảo
- Hàm được định nghĩa là def subComplex[ a, b]
- Hàm được trả về dưới dạng return a – b
- Tôi đã sử dụng print[“Kết quả là. “, subComplex[a, b]] để lấy đầu ra
Thí dụ
a = complex[9, 8]
b = complex[3, 5]
def subComplex[ a, b]:
return a - b
print[ "Result is : ", subComplex[a, b]]
Chúng ta có thể xem phép trừ số thực và số ảo là đầu ra. Ảnh chụp màn hình bên dưới hiển thị đầu ra
Đoạn mã trên, chúng ta có thể sử dụng để trừ số phức trong Python
Chương trình trừ các số sử dụng lớp
Ở đây, chúng ta có thể xem cách viết chương trình trừ các số bằng class trong python
- Trong ví dụ này, tôi đã sử dụng phương thức input[]. để lấy đầu vào từ người dùng
- Tôi đã tạo một lớp bằng hàm tạo để khởi tạo giá trị của lớp
- Tôi đã tạo một phương pháp để trừ các số
- Đối tượng được tạo cho lớp truyền tham số
- Bản thân là từ khóa được sử dụng để truyền các thuộc tính và phương thức cho lớp
- Để có được đầu ra, tôi đã sử dụng print[“Result. “,obj. số[]]
Thí dụ
a=int[input["Enter first number: "]]
b=int[input["Enter second number: "]]
class sub[]:
def __init__[self,a,b]:
self.a=a
self.b=b
def num[self]:
return self.a-self.b
obj=sub[a,b]
print["Result: ",obj.num[]]
Ảnh chụp màn hình bên dưới hiển thị đầu ra
Đây là cách chúng ta có thể trừ các số bằng lớp trong Python
Lập trình trừ các số không dùng toán tử số học
Ở đây, chúng ta có thể xem cách viết chương trình trừ các số mà không cần sử dụng toán tử số học trong python
- Trong ví dụ này, tôi đã định nghĩa một hàm là deftrừ[a,b]
- Điều kiện if được sử dụng, Nếu điều kiện đúng nó trả về một
- Nếu điều kiện không đúng, nó trả về return ab[a ^ b, [~a & b]